Transaction fae69cb7f8a75eac36e3872a7a2ce82395fe652416425c06c004756c7ef9b59a
1 Input
1 Output
-
fae69cb7f8a75eac36e3872a7a2ce82395fe652416425c06c004756c7ef9b59a:0
- value
- 2684883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ca0ca3392a9e43b5f0248ba023e3792c02e6551 OP_EQUAL
- address
- 38gBtzoiFZc88usfFZE7Acd8X3Bex2ZVqg